Why Live in Mccomb

McComb, Mississippi, a small city with a rich railroad history, is located south of Jackson. With a population of around 12,000, McComb offers a variety of things to do, particularly for outdoor enthusiasts. Edgewood Park and Percy Quin State Park, which features Lake Tangipahoa and the Quail Hollow Golf Course, are popular local spots. The nearby Homochitto National Forest is renowned for its hunting opportunities. McComb's housing market is characterized by affordable prices, with most homes being brick ranchers from the 1950s to the 1990s. The city’s economy is supported by major employers like Wayne-Sanderson Farms and the Southwest Mississippi Regional Medical Center. McComb also has a vibrant cultural scene, with the Mississippi Blues Trail, the historic Palace Theater, and annual events like the Azalea Festival and the McComb Christmas Parade. Shopping options include Uptown McComb and various stores along Delaware Avenue and Veterans Boulevard. Interstate 55 provides easy access to Jackson, Baton Rouge, and Hattiesburg. However, potential residents should be aware of the area's susceptibility to hurricanes and tornadoes, as well as the high summer temperatures.
